after the first look, I would also possibly swap the sink and dishwasher. That way you have more workspace between the sink and the stove.
I would also get rid of the pull-out pantry cabinet; they are quite expensive.
I consider the 1 m passageway to be okay, it is a passageway....
However, it would really be something to consider swapping the tall cabinet/oven and refrigerator. When someone is standing in front of the open refrigerator door, the passageway is blocked. In a private setting, though, I find that acceptable. It's not a restaurant kitchen where 3 chefs and 7 waiters are running around. At home, usually a maximum of 2 people are working in the kitchen.
I consider the budget to be completely sufficient; however, you won't be able to realize a stone countertop with it.
